Walsall Branch

Your local RSPCA

Find us on

Walsall Branch

The Walsall Branch is one of over 150 charities that supports the local work of the RSPCA and it's inspectors.

As a local voluntary run branch, we do not have an animal centre. All of our animals are cared for in foster homes.

As a separately registered branch of the RSPCA we are primarily responsible for raising funds locally to help animals in our area. We are run by local volunteers and raise money through fundraising events, donations and legacies.


We are currently unable to offer any welfare assistance until further notice.


Rehome a pet - can you offer a home to an animal in our care?